You don't need to completely disconnect your ethernet cable. Just don't log into any profiles on your Xbox so that you're not connected to Live. Then go change the system clock and play the demo. As noted by gstatus904, logging into Live automatically adjusts your system clock to the correct date and time which means the Too Human trick won't work.
